>> The problem with DBT and Great Expectations (and Soda too, I believe) is 
>> that by the time they find the problem, the error is already in production - 
>> and fixing production can be a nightmare. 
>> 
>> What's more, we've found that nobody ever looks at the data quality reports 
>> we already generate.
>> 
>> You can, of course, run DBT, GT etc as part of a CI/CD pipeline but it's 
>> usually against synthetic or at best sampled data (laws like GDPR generally 
>> stop personal information data being anywhere but prod).
>> 
>> What I'm proposing is something that stops production data ever being 
>> tainted.

>> The problem here is that a schema itself won't protect me (at least as I 
>> understand your argument). For instance, I have medical records that say 
>> some of my patients are 999 years old which is clearly ridiculous but their 
>> age correctly conforms to an integer data type. I have other patients who 
>> were discharged before they were admitted to hospital. I have 28 patients 
>> out of literally millions who recently attended hospital but were discharged 
>> on 1/1/1900. As you can imagine, this made the average length of stay (a key 
>> metric for acute hospitals) much lower than it should have been. It only 
>> came to light when some average length of stays were negative! 
>> 
>> In all these cases, the data faithfully adhered to the schema.

>>> Thanks for raising this. I like the idea. The question is, should this be 
>>> implemented in Spark or some other framework? I know that dbt has a fairly 
>>> extensive way of testing your data 
>>> <https://www.getdbt.com/product/data-testing/>, and making sure that you 
>>> can enforce assumptions on the columns. The nice thing about dbt is that it 
>>> is built from a software engineering perspective, so all the tests (or 
>>> contracts) are living in version control. Using pull requests you could 
>>> collaborate on changing the contract and making sure that the change has 
>>> gotten enough attention before pushing it to production. Hope this helps!

>>>>> While not as fine-grained as your example, there do exist schema systems 
>>>>> such as that in Avro that can can evaluate compatible and incompatible 
>>>>> changes to the schema, from the perspective of the reader, writer, or 
>>>>> both. This provides some potential degree of enforcement, and means to 
>>>>> communicate a contract. Interestingly I believe this approach has been 
>>>>> applied to both JsonSchema and protobuf as part of the Confluent Schema 
>>>>> registry.

>>>>>> There currently seems to be a buzz around "data contracts". From what I 
>>>>>> can tell, these mainly advocate a cultural solution. But instead, could 
>>>>>> big data tools be used to enforce these contracts?
>>>>>> 
>>>>>> My questions really are: are there any plans to implement data 
>>>>>> constraints in Spark (eg, an integer must be between 0 and 100; the date 
>>>>>> in column X must be before that in column Y)? And if not, is there an 
>>>>>> appetite for them?
>>>>>> 
>>>>>> Maybe we could associate constraints with schema metadata that are 
>>>>>> enforced in the implementation of a FileFormatDataWriter?
>>>>>> 
>>>>>> Just throwing it out there and wondering what other people think. It's 
>>>>>> an area that interests me as it seems that over half my problems at the 
>>>>>> day job are because of dodgy data.
